Influence of the hematopoietic stem cell source on early immunohematologic reconstitution after allogeneic transplantation.

Abstract

Several acute hemolysis episodes, sometimes lethal, have been recently described after transplantation of allogeneic peripheral blood hematopoietic stem cells (PBHSCs). Hemolysis resulted from the production of donor-derived antibodies (Abs) directed at ABO antigens (Ags) present on recipient red blood cells (RBCs). A multicenter randomized phase III clinical study comparing allogeneic PBHSC transplantation (PBHSCT) versus bone marrow h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(BMHSCT) has been conducted in France. In the course of this study, serum anti-A and/or anti-B Ab titers were compared before the conditioning regimen and on day +30 after transplantation in 49 consecutive evaluable PBHSCT (n = 21) or BMHSCT (n = 28) recipients. PBHSCT resulted in a higher frequency of increased anti-A and/or anti-B Ab titers 30 days after transplantation as compared to BMHSCT: 8 (38%) of 21 versus 3 (11%) of 28 (P =.04). In PBHSCT recipients, increased titers were observed mostly after receiving a minor ABO mismatch transplant: 5 of 7 versus 3 of 14 in the absence of any minor ABO mismatch (P =.05), whereas this was not the case after BMHSCT: 1 of 8 versus 2 of 20. Blood And Marrow Transplantation

The use of hematopoietic stem cell transplantation or blood and marrow transplantation (bmt) is on the increase worldwide. BMT is used to replace damaged or destroyed bone marrow with healthy bone marrow stem cells. Here is the latest research on bone and marrow transplantation.

Allogenic & Autologous Therapies

Allogenic therapies are generated in large batches from unrelated donor tissues such as bone marrow. In contrast, autologous therapies are manufactures as a single lot from the patient being treated. Here is the latest research on allogenic and autologous therapies.
